Lines Matching refs:Handle

34   Handle<CompilationCacheTable> GetTable(int generation);
37 Handle<CompilationCacheTable> GetFirstTable() {
40 void SetFirstTable(Handle<CompilationCacheTable> value) {
57 void Remove(Handle<SharedFunctionInfo> function_info);
79 Handle<SharedFunctionInfo> Lookup(Handle<String> source, Handle<Object> name,
82 Handle<Context> context,
84 void Put(Handle<String> source,
85 Handle<Context> context,
87 Handle<SharedFunctionInfo> function_info);
90 bool HasOrigin(Handle<SharedFunctionInfo> function_info, Handle<Object> name,
115 MaybeHandle<SharedFunctionInfo> Lookup(Handle<String> source,
116 Handle<SharedFunctionInfo> outer_info,
120 void Put(Handle<String> source, Handle<SharedFunctionInfo> outer_info,
121 Handle<SharedFunctionInfo> function_info, int scope_position);
134 MaybeHandle<FixedArray> Lookup(Handle<String> source, JSRegExp::Flags flags);
136 void Put(Handle<String> source,
138 Handle<FixedArray> data);
154 Handle<String> source, Handle<Object> name, int line_offset,
156 Handle<Context> context, LanguageMode language_mode);
162 Handle<String> source, Handle<SharedFunctionInfo> outer_info,
163 Handle<Context> context, LanguageMode language_mode, int scope_position);
168 Handle<String> source, JSRegExp::Flags flags);
172 void PutScript(Handle<String> source,
173 Handle<Context> context,
175 Handle<SharedFunctionInfo> function_info);
179 void PutEval(Handle<String> source, Handle<SharedFunctionInfo> outer_info,
180 Handle<Context> context,
181 Handle<SharedFunctionInfo> function_info, int scope_position);
185 void PutRegExp(Handle<String> source,
187 Handle<FixedArray> data);
193 void Remove(Handle<SharedFunctionInfo> function_info);